33-12.5/17 tires
Is it possible to put 33-12.5/17 ProComp AT tires or any other tire brand for that matter, on stock Ford 17" rims. I have the ORP, and want to keep stock rims, which are 7.5" wide. The procomp website states I would need an 8" rim for this size tire. Anyone done this with stock. I originally put my ProComps on my stock 17X7.5 wheels and they worked fine. They fit and ride fine.

My truck is a stock SuperCrew 4x4 ORP(just got it Thursday - I ordered it). The tires fit with no rubbing under any conditions (sharp turns, crossing small ditch, etc.). I haven't been in heavy off road situations but I don't think they will rub there either.
Two things though. First, I've heard they may rub on some mud flaps which I don't have yet but a little trimming fixes that. Second, my SuperCrew sits up higher than my neighbors SuperCab so I don't how they would work on it.
